如何在服务器导入证书
-
在服务器上导入证书需要按照以下步骤进行操作:
-
准备证书文件:在开始之前,您需要获得一个有效的证书文件。证书文件通常是以.pem或.crt为扩展名的文件,可以从证书颁发机构或自己生成。
-
登录到服务器:使用SSH或其他远程连接工具登录到目标服务器。
-
确定证书存储位置:在服务器上,证书通常存储在特定的目录中。常见的证书存储位置包括/etc/ssl/certs、/usr/local/ssl/certs等。
-
将证书文件上传到服务器:使用SCP或其他文件传输工具将证书文件从本地计算机上传到服务器。确保将证书文件上传到正确的目录。
-
导入证书文件:使用以下命令将证书文件导入到服务器中:
sudo cp /path/to/certificate.crt /etc/ssl/certs/请注意,您需要根据实际情况修改上述命令中的证书文件路径和目标存储位置。
-
配置服务器应用程序:导入证书后,您需要配置服务器应用程序以使用新的证书。具体的配置步骤取决于您使用的服务器应用程序。通常,您需要编辑服务器配置文件,并将证书文件的路径指定为配置文件中适当的位置。
-
重启服务器应用程序:完成配置后,您需要重新启动服务器应用程序以使更改生效。使用以下命令重新启动服务器应用程序:
sudo service apache2 restart请注意,上述命令适用于Apache服务器,如果您使用的是其他服务器应用程序,您需要使用适当的命令。
导入证书的具体步骤取决于您使用的服务器操作系统和应用程序。请仔细阅读相关文档,并根据实际情况进行操作。确保按照正确的步骤操作,以避免对服务器造成不必要的风险。
1年前 -
-
在服务器上导入证书通常涉及以下步骤:
-
生成私钥和证书签名请求 (CSR):在服务器上生成私钥并创建CSR文件。私钥将用于加密通信,而CSR则包含对证书颁发机构 (CA) 的请求,以获取有效的数字证书。
-
购买或获取证书:选择证书颁发机构并购买适当的服务器证书。根据需求选择正确的证书类型,如单域名证书、多域名证书或通配符证书。
-
下载证书文件:在确定了证书颁发机构之后,按照提供的指导下载证书文件。这通常包括主证书和中间证书。
-
将证书和私钥文件上传到服务器:使用安全的方式将证书和私钥文件上传到服务器。根据服务器操作系统和配置,可以使用SFTP、SCP或其他安全协议来上传文件。
-
在服务器上配置证书:根据服务器软件和配置,找到相应的位置来导入证书。对于常见的服务器软件,如Apache、NGINX和IIS,可以在配置文件中找到相关的指令或界面来导入证书。
-
配置服务器以使用证书:导入证书后,需要相应地配置服务器以使用该证书。这可能涉及到修改服务器配置文件或通过管理界面进行设置。
-
测试证书安装:重新启动服务器或重新加载配置文件后,进行一些测试来确保证书的正确安装。您可以使用在线工具或命令行工具来检查证书的有效性和安装情况。
请注意,以上步骤是一般性的指导,具体的操作步骤可能因服务器软件、操作系统以及特定的证书颁发机构而略有不同。建议在进行证书导入之前查阅适用的文档和指南,以确保正确地导入证书和配置服务器。
1年前 -
-
在服务器上导入证书,需要以下步骤:
-
启用SSL功能:在开始之前,确保服务器已启用SSL功能。这通常可以在服务器配置或管理面板中完成。
-
准备证书文件:在开始导入证书之前,确保你已准备好SSL证书。通常,你会从证书颁发机构(CA)收到一个包含证书的文件。这个文件通常是一个包含.crt后缀的文件,也可能包含CA的中间证书。
-
查找服务器配置文件:根据你使用的服务器软件,找到服务器的配置文件。对于常见的服务器软件如Apache、Nginx或IIS,配置文件通常位于特定的目录中。例如,在Apache上,配置文件是httpd.conf或apache.conf,在Nginx上,配置文件是nginx.conf,在IIS上,配置文件是web.config。
-
打开服务器配置文件:使用文本编辑器打开服务器配置文件,并找到关于SSL的部分。对于Apache,通常在
标签下,对于Nginx和IIS,通常在server块内。如果找不到SSL部分,请确保安装了正确的模块或插件。 -
配置证书路径:在SSL部分中,找到指定证书路径和密钥路径的配置项。根据你的证书文件,修改配置项的值为证书文件的绝对路径。通常,指定证书路径的配置项是SSLCertificateFile,而指定私钥路径的配置项是SSLCertificateKeyFile。
-
导入CA的中间证书(可选):如果你的证书文件包含CA的中间证书,你需要将它导入服务器。这是为了确保客户端的浏览器可以验证你的证书。通常,中间证书以.bundle或.ca-bundle结尾的文件提供。在服务器配置文件中,找到配置项SSLCertificateChainFile,并将其值修改为中间证书文件的绝对路径。
-
保存并关闭服务器配置文件:保存对服务器配置文件的更改,并关闭文件。
-
重新启动服务器:根据你的服务器软件,通过执行相应的命令或操作,重新启动服务器以使更改生效。例如,对于Apache,可以使用命令“sudo service apache2 restart”重新启动。
完成这些步骤后,服务器应该已经成功导入了SSL证书。你可以通过使用https来访问你的网站来验证证书是否成功导入。
1年前 -